然而,在使用虚拟机时,用户可能会遇到各种挑战,其中之一便是虚拟机中的Windows 10系统不显示WiFi的问题
这不仅影响了网络连接的便捷性,还可能对日常工作和娱乐造成不便
本文将深入剖析这一现象背后的原因,并提供一系列全面而有效的解决方案,帮助用户迅速恢复虚拟机的WiFi功能
一、现象描述与影响分析 虚拟机Win10不显示WiFi,通常表现为在Windows 10的任务栏或设置中没有WiFi网络的选项,无法搜索或连接到任何无线网络
这一问题不仅限制了虚拟机内部系统的无线连接能力,还可能影响到依赖于网络的应用程序的正常运行,如远程桌面、在线会议、文件同步等
对于依赖虚拟机进行开发测试、在线教育或远程办公的用户而言,这无疑是一个亟待解决的痛点
二、问题根源探析 虚拟机Win10不显示WiFi的问题,其根源复杂多样,主要包括以下几个方面: 1.虚拟机设置不当:虚拟机的网络适配器配置错误或未正确安装相关驱动是导致此问题的常见原因
例如,网络适配器类型选择不当(如桥接模式、NAT模式或仅主机模式设置不当),或者未启用虚拟机的WiFi硬件支持
2.Windows 10系统问题:虚拟机内部的Windows 10系统可能存在网络堆栈损坏、服务异常或更新导致的不兼容性问题,这些都会影响WiFi功能的正常显示和使用
3.宿主机硬件与软件限制:宿主机的无线网卡驱动不兼容、虚拟机软件(如VMware、VirtualBox等)版本过旧或存在已知bug,也可能导致虚拟机无法识别或使用WiFi
4.安全软件干扰:防火墙、杀毒软件等安全软件可能会误将虚拟机的网络活动视为潜在威胁,从而阻止或限制WiFi功能的访问
三、全面解决方案 针对上述原因,以下提供了一系列实用的解决方案,旨在帮助用户快速定位并解决问题: 1. 检查并调整虚拟机网络设置 - 确认网络适配器类型:根据需求选择合适的网络适配器类型
对于需要访问外部网络的情况,NAT模式通常是一个不错的选择;若需要虚拟机与宿主机直接通信且能访问外部网络,则桥接模式更为合适
- 启用WiFi硬件支持:在虚拟机设置中确保启用了WiFi硬件支持,这通常在“USB控制器”或“高级”设置中配置
2. 更新与修复Windows 10系统 - 运行网络诊断工具:Windows 10自带的网络诊断工具可以自动检测并修复一些常见的网络问题
- 更新网络驱动:访问设备管理器,检查并更新无线网络适配器的驱动程序
有时,手动下载最新的驱动程序并安装可以解决问题
- 系统还原:如果问题出现在最近的系统更新后,可以尝试使用系统还原功能恢复到更新前的状态
3. 检查宿主机硬件与软件 - 更新虚拟机软件:确保虚拟机软件(如VMware Workstation、VirtualBox等)为最新版本,以利用最新的功能和修复已知问题
- 检查宿主机无线网卡驱动:更新宿主机的无线网卡驱动程序,确保其与虚拟机软件兼容
- 禁用或调整安全软件:暂时禁用防火墙或杀毒软件,观察问题是否得到解决
如果问题解决,考虑调整安全软件的设置,允许虚拟机的网络活动
4. 高级故障排除 - 重新安装虚拟机网络适配器:在虚拟机设置中删除并重新安装网络适配器,有时可以解决硬件识别问题
- 使用命令行工具:通过Windows命令提示符或PowerShell执行网络重置命令,如`netsh winsock reset`和`netsh int ipreset`,以修复可能损坏的网络堆栈
- 检查BIOS/UEFI设置:极少数情况下,宿主机的BIOS/UEFI设置可能限制了虚拟机的网络功能
检查并确认相关设置(如虚拟化技术支持)已正确启用
四、预防措施与最佳实践 为了避免虚拟机Win10不显示WiFi的问题再次发生,建议采取以下预防措施和最佳实践: - 定期更新软件:保持虚拟机软件、Windows操作系统以及所有相关驱动的定期更新
- 谨慎安装第三方软件:避免在虚拟机中安装来源不明的软件,以防引入潜在的冲突或安全问题
- 备份重要数据:定期备份虚拟机中的重要数据,以防万一需要重装或重置系统
- 监控与日志分析:利用虚拟机软件的监控功能和系统日志,及时发现并处理潜在的网络问题
五、结语 虚拟机Win10不显示WiFi的问题虽然复杂,但通过仔细检查和逐一排查上述解决方案,大多数用户都能找到适合自己的解决之道
重要的是,保持对技术的敏锐度和持续学习的态度,以便在面对类似挑战时能够迅速作出反应
随着技术的不断进步,我们有理由相信,未来的虚拟机将更加稳定、高效,为用户提供更加无缝的网络体验